Here is an update from Craft Buddy in regards to the alleged Johanna Basford Copyright infringement Cushion Kits on its Create & Craft shows last week

From the screenshot.

Dear Crafters,

We now have an update for those of you who purchased our Cushion Kits on our Create & Craft shows last week. We’ve reached an amicable agreement with artist Johanna Basford, who we informed immediately when we discovered that some of the designs on the kits resembled her original artworks. We’ve agreed with Johanna to send the kits to charity, so that the kits can still be of benefit.
Thank you for your patience in waiting for an update; we’re sorry to disappoint those of you who ordered the kits; A member of the Create and Craft customers services team will be in touch with you shortly.
We thank Johanna for her co-operation and understanding, which enabled us to reach a swift resolution to this matter. We take artist intellectual property rights extremely seriously, and on this occasion we were misled by a manufacturer who claimed to own the rights to the designs that we marketed; our internal procedures have been reviewed and improved to ensure this never happens again.
